  • Demonstrating the benefits of orthotic management in patients with rheumatoid arthritis, sports injuries, diabetes as well as paediatric patients. It allows the viewer to appreciate the assessment, diagnosis and treatment of those conditions affecting the foot and ankle. The video explains the processes around the casting and manufacture of the various devices that are provided to patients with such pathologies like flat feet and shin splints. Understanding the other adjunct treatments involved in these cases is also important and include stretching exercises and steroid injections.

      Podiatrists who train in the UK undergo a 3-4 year degree in Podiatry. They can assess diagnose and treat a whole range of foot problems.       Currently, podiatrists who possess the relevant annotations on the Health and Care Professions Council register have rights to the sale and supply and/or administration of various prescription only medicines and pharmacy only medicines, alongside rights to the sale or supply of general sales list medicines.
